Xi Jinping and Central Asian Leaders Sign Historic Good-Neighborliness Treaty

Chinese President Xi Jinping and leaders from five Central Asian countries have signed a landmark treaty of permanent good-neighborliness and friendly cooperation.

The signing ceremony marked a new chapter in regional relations, aiming to strengthen ties and promote peace and development across Central Asia.

Experts believe the treaty will enhance economic collaboration, cultural exchanges, and security cooperation between China and its Central Asian neighbors.

“This agreement signifies a shared commitment to mutual respect and common development,” noted observers.

With this agreement, the nations are set to explore new opportunities in trade, infrastructure, and energy, contributing to the well-being of their peoples.

This historic treaty is expected to pave the way for a brighter future in Central Asia, rooted in friendship and cooperation.
